It nudges you into a frantic betting pattern that mirrors the rapid reels of a high\u2011payline slot, where each spin feels like a gamble against the house\u2019s hidden timer.<\/p>\n<h2>Calculating the Real Value \u2013 A Cold\u2011Hard Example<\/h2>\n<p>Assume you meet the 30\u00d7 requirement with the minimum bet of \u00a32.5. That means you need to wager \u00a36,000. If you can sustain a 95\u202f% return\u2011to\u2011player (RTP) on average, your expected loss is \u00a3300. Subtract the \u00a3200 bonus, and you\u2019re left with a net negative of \u00a3100 before any withdrawal fees.<\/p>\n<p>Now, contrast that with a slower 200\u2011deposit bonus that requires a 20\u00d7 turnover. At the same \u00a32.5 bet, you\u2019d need \u00a35,000 of wagering, cutting your expected loss to \u00a3250. The difference is a tidy \u00a350 \u2013 the ten\u2011minute gimmick costs you more than it pretends to give.<\/p>\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/suhilaboutique.com\/ar\/?p=30650\">Best Trustworthy Online Casino Scams Unmasked \u2013 Why the \u201cFree\u201d Glitter Isn\u2019t Worth Your Wallet<\/a><\/p>\n<p>Because most players chase the \u201cinstant win\u201d narrative, they overlook the arithmetic.
